TO MANUALLY BACK UP YOUR FILES AND FOLDERS TO THE MAXTOR EXTERNAL HARD DRIVE:
1) Right-click on any file or folder you want to copy to the Maxtor, then click on Send To, then on F: Drive or whatever drive letter your Maxtor is. The Maxtor will have an icon that looks like a silver hard drive standing vertically. We will use F: Drive in these instructions.
2) Wait a few moments for the file/folder to be copied.
The procedure is a little different for Shortcuts. These shortcuts are just icons; they are not the actual file or folder. To find the actual file or folder:
1) Right-click on the Shortcut.
2) Click on Properties.
3) Click on Find Target. This will show you the actual file or folder in its original location.
[4) Unfortunately, you cannot just right-click on the My Documents folder to copy the contents of the folder to the Maxtor (you can do this for a simple data file, but not the My Documents folder). You must do the following for the My Documents folder:
1) Double-click on the My Documents folder to open it.
2) Click once on any one file.
3) Click on Edit, then on Select All (or press Ctrl-A).
4) Right-click on any one file that is highlighted, then click on Send To, then on F: Drive. The rest of the files will be copied, too.
5) Wait a few moments for the files to be copied. You can then click once anywhere to get rid of the highlighting on all the files.]
